bug: https://bugs.openjdk.java.net/browse/JDK-8209566
The fix for JDK-8212028 decreased the timeout factor from 10 to 4. This
test has been timing out occasionally in tier6 testing.
The timeout could be reproduced by running the test on a solaris/sparc
host many times. After increasing the timeout to 240, the timeout was
not seen.
Before the timeout factor change, the effective timeout is: 120s
(default) x 10 = 1200s.
With this change, the effective timeout is: 240s x 4 = 960s.
Below is the diff:
